New partnership offers the next generation instruments for visibility and aerosol studies to British Isles’ environmental monitoring sector
Jul 09 2021
Enviro Technology Services (ET) has teamed up with California’s Nikira Labs, to offer the UK and Irish market access to a range of next-generation, highly portable, optical extinction analysers which cater for a wide array of visibility and aerosol monitoring applications.
Nikira’s OEA-532 has merged open-path cavity ringdown measurement with their unique, patented self-referencing system to create an optical extinction/visibility in air analyser with unsurpassed accuracy, negligible sample handling and minimal or no drift. This analyser has a host of applications and has been widely used at airports, roads, tunnels, air quality and pollution monitoring networks, forests, aerosol research and for clean room and semi-conductor fabrication and research.
The versatile and portable OEA-532 is light (7.7 kg) and compact (49 x 33 x 18 cms) and housed in a tough, durable and water-resistant Pelican case. Low power consumption (35 watts) enables the OEA-532 to operate on battery power for lengthy periods of time in locations where mains power is inaccessible. This analyser includes onboard data storage for up to 2 years of continuous usage. Data is accessible through a USB connection or remotely with a cellular modem. This single wavelength (532 nm) analyser comes in two formats: a standard 1-Hz or a super-fast 10-Hz version catering for Eddy Covariance applications, the Model OEA-532EC.
